Frequently Asked Questions
What is the ICD-10 code for other forms of blastomycosis?
The ICD-10-CM code for other forms of blastomycosis is B40.89. The full clinical description is "Other forms of blastomycosis". B40.89 is a billable/specific code that can be used on insurance claims and medical billing.
What does ICD-10 code B40.89 mean?
ICD-10-CM code B40.89 represents “Other forms of blastomycosis”. It is classified under Chapter 1: Certain Infectious and Parasitic Diseases and is a billable/specific code that can be used on a claim.
Is B40.89 a billable code?
Yes, B40.89 is a billable/specific ICD-10-CM code and can be used to indicate a diagnosis on a medical claim.
What chapter is B40.89 in?
B40.89 is in Chapter 1: Certain Infectious and Parasitic Diseases (codes A00-B99).
What codes cannot be used with B40.89?
B40.89 has Excludes1 notes indicating codes that cannot be used together with it, including: certain localized infections - see body system-related chapters; Brazilian blastomycosis (B41.-); keloidal blastomycosis (B48.0).
Are additional codes required with B40.89?
Yes, when using B40.89, also report: resistance to antimicrobial drugs (Z16.-).
